- Here's a snippet of what went on at Tuesday's Board of Commissioners meeting: Commissioner Tommy DeWeese presented a proclamation recognizing Sept. 17-23, as Constitution Week. In addition, Mayor Miles Atkins read a proclamation recognizing September as Suicide Prevention Month and Sept. 10-16, as Suicide Prevention Week and the Finance Department was recognized for obtaining the Award for Outstanding Achievement in Popular Financial Reporting 2022. This is the fourth year in a row the department has earned this prestigious award! Congratulations! (Town of Mooresville NC via Facebook)
- Did you know it is National Preparedness Month? The Mooresville Police Department is encouraging residents to keep a 72-hour emergency preparedness kit. Mooresville Fire-Rescue's Fire Marshal Woody and Ready.gov have some more suggestions of what to keep in your kit, such as water, non-perishable food that can last several days, a manual can opener, flashlights, first aid kit, batteries, phone chargers and portable battery packs, battery operated radio and a fire extinguisher. In addition, things like prescription medication, hand sanitizer, disinfecting wipes, non-prescription medication such as pain relievers, prescription glasses, extra contact lenses, pet food and extra water for your pet, a sleeping bag or warm blanket for each person and activities to keep everyone entertained, such as books, coloring books and crayons, puzzles, and games.
